This page compares King James's School and Kirkburton Middle School in Huddersfield.
King James's School scores 58 out of 100 (grade C, average) and Kirkburton Middle School scores 58 out of 100 (grade C, average). Our score is the same for each of them on the data available.
King James's School was judged Good and Kirkburton Middle School was judged the expected standard.
The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has fallen at Kirkburton Middle School (65.0% in 2022-23, 62.0% in 2024-25).
